Registered Nurse- Child & Family Services

Share:

The Registered Nurse promotes the healthy growth and development of children with the responsibility of delivering health services for Head Start, Early Head Start, School Readiness and Home-Based programs.  This work is done in compliance with all applicable Federal, State and local regulations.  The Registered Nurse works closely with the Health and Nutrition Services Coordinator, Health Specialist, and other content area and management staff to ensure that children receive high-quality, comprehensive, hands-on care such as first-aid, health screenings, and monitoring the daily health statuses of children. Coordinates with the Health and Nutrition Manager and Health Specialist to provide training, mentoring, and support to staff in areas of expertise.  

 

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Nursing or Associate’s degree in Nursing in Massachusetts
  • Minimum of two years of experience in pediatrics, school health, or community health 
  • Knowledge of community resources in the field of maternal child health care
  • Demonstrated ability to work as a member of a multidisciplinary, multiethnic team
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Ability to communicate in an articulate manner to leadership and staff
  • Ability to communicate with children and families
  • Excellent problem-solving and conflict resolution skills
  • Flexibility
  • Ability to travel to home-visit sites
  • Ability to handle multiple priorities
  • Head Start experience preferred
  • Experience working with diverse populations is a plus
  • Bilingual (English-Spanish or English-Creole) is a plus
